Honesto "Nes" Flores Ongtioco (born October 17, 1948) is a Filipino bishop of the Catholic Church. He served as the first Bishop of Cubao from August 28, 2003 until his retirement on December 3, 2024.

Prior to his position to Cubao, he previously served as the rector of Pontifical Filipino College from 1997 to June 18, 1998 and second Bishop of Balanga in Bataan from June 1998 to August 28, 2003. He also served as apostolic administrator of the Diocese of Malolos from May 12, 2018 to August 21, 2019.
